Partial Ship transfer orders
We use the new Transfer Order transaction for my retail stores to request to have inventory transferred to their stores from our warehouse. Currently, we are limited to fulfilling everything, or nothing, and the retail stores have to receive everything or nothing.
Due to human error, sometimes the warehouse person may fulfill something, but it does not end up at the retail store. In this case, my retail store manager cannot receive in only what he received, but must either receive it all, or nothing. This causes back-up problems because I (an office staff person having nothing to do this maintaining/fulfilling inventory) have to go back and remove the fulfillment, then edit the transfer order to be exactly what was transferred, then recreate the fulfillment.
